I believe you’ll have to boot into a live environment, and enter a chroot environment from there. There, the logs can be inspected and errors corrected. Do you have a relatively new(ish) bootable (preferable Manjaro) USB thumb drive available? Or at least one with an LTS kernel?

Next Solution: Plug Your Pendrive and Goto live Boot then Mount your Drive and Access Old OS Like This
Open Terminal Then Find your OS Installed Disk command:
fdisk -l
if you find your disk then copy the path /dev/sdxx
Here xx means your Drive and Partition number. if your Device has One SSD or HDD you will see this /dev/sdax
here a represent your SSD or HDD x represent partition number like 1,2,3,4…n
Now We Get Your OS installation Path So mount this Drive in /mnt folder
mount /dev/sdaX /mnt # mount <your Drive Path> /mnt
mount -B /dev /mnt/dev
mount -B /dev/pts /mnt/dev/pts
mount -B /proc /mnt/proc
mount -B /sys /mnt/sys
mount -B /run /mnt/run
chroot /mnt
Now You are in your old OS now change add these lines to /etc/default/grub.d/90_custom.cfg:
echo -e 'GRUB_TIMEOUT="15"\nGRUB_TIMEOUT_STYLE="menu"' >> /etc/default/grub.d/90_custom.cfg
mkinitcpio -P
update-grub
OR if you think your update isn’t complete then you can again recheck your update
pacman -Syyuu
